Following up on her 2008 debut, Youth Novels, Swedish singer Lykke Li unveils her album cover for new album, Wounded Rhymes, which she created together with Australian Leif Podhajsky. Something brand new from critically acclaimed Swedish indie singer Lykke Li whos single “Little Bit” you may remember was remixed by Drake for his So Far Gone mixtape. “Get Some” x “Paris Blue” are brand new new songs from Ms Li’s forthcoming sophomore album that she has just unveiled via her website for free download [...]
